News Item: Businesses Trading with Europe Offered Tax and Customs Support
Additional customs and tax support is available from HM Revenue and Customs (HMRC) for VAT-registered businesses that trade with the European Union.
All UK-based VAT-registered businesses will receive a letter from HMRC. In addition, over 170,000 customers of those companies receive weekly email updates.
HMRC recognises the challenges businesses face adapting to the sheer number of changes to these rules, complicated even further by the conditions imposed due to coronavirus. The SME Brexit Support Fund was created to support businesses and can pay up to £2,000 to go towards professional advice or training on customs rules and VAT where needed.
There will be a six-month delay before these border controls are implemented to allow time to prepare and adapt to changes. In addition, HMRC has added personnel and extended the operating hours of its Customs and International Trade helpline to cope with a higher volume of enquiries, and will continue to run a series of live support webinars.
